Can You Use Cable With a Roku TV?

Yes—you can use cable with a Roku TV, but only if your TV has a cable/antenna input (and the right setup) to feed the signal into the tuner. If you have traditional coax cable, plug it into the TV’s cable/antenna port and scan for channels; if you’re using cable box service, you’ll typically connect the box via HDMI. Check Your Cable Connection Type

The fastest path to watching cable on a Roku TV starts by identifying your cable feed type. Most service providers deliver either a coax/RF line (common for “Antenna/Cable” setups) or an HDMI output from a cable/satellite box—knowing which one you have prevents hours of troubleshooting.

In my hands-on setup work with Roku TVs across different households, the biggest time-saver is simply confirming whether the cable wall outlet ends in coax (F-type) or whether you already have a set-top cable box with HDMI. Roku’s model lineup varies by region, but the core concept stays the same: Roku can display whatever the input source provides, and the channel scan step only works when Roku is receiving a tunable RF/cable signal.

Roku TVs typically support direct live TV tuning through a coax/RF input labeled “Antenna” or “Cable,” enabling an on-device channel scan.
If your cable provider uses an external cable box, live channels are usually delivered over HDMI, not coax, so Roku’s tuner scan is not required for those channels.
A coax/RF connection uses an F-type threaded connector and carries the same kind of RF signal used by many TVs’ built-in tuners.

What to look for (so you don’t pick the wrong port)

– Identify whether your cable feed uses coax (RF) or another connection

Coax/RF: a single cable with an F-type connector from the wall to the TV (or to a splitter).

No coax at the TV: your setup may already route cable through a provider box to HDMI.

– Locate the matching port on your Roku TV (e.g., Antenna/Cable/coax)

– On most Roku TVs, look for a port labeled Antenna/Cable, RF In, or Antenna.

– If your wall outlet is coax, you’ll generally need an RF connection to use Roku’s built-in channel tuner.

Connect Cable to Your Roku TV

The right connection is simple: plug your cable signal into the Roku TV input that matches your setup, and make sure both devices are powered. Once the physical connection is correct, Roku’s channel scanning (for coax) or HDMI input selection (for a cable box) does the rest.

If you’re using coax, the main goal is ensuring the connector is fully seated and threaded—RF signals are sensitive to loose fittings. If you’re using HDMI from a cable box, the key goal is selecting the correct HDMI input and confirming the cable box is actually outputting a live channel.

For direct coax setups, the Roku TV must be connected to the “Antenna/Cable” (RF) input before running the Roku channel scan.
For cable-box setups, Roku displays the cable box’s live channels only when the TV is set to the HDMI input connected to that box.

Step-by-step connection checklist

– Use the correct cable/adapter for your setup

Coax: connect wall coax → Roku TV “Antenna/Cable/RF In” using a standard coax (F-type) cable.

Adapter cases: if the outlet is not coax-to-F-type (older hardware happens), use the appropriate adapter—but only if it’s compatible with RF signal paths.

– Plug in securely and power on both the TV and cable source (if applicable)

– If using a cable box, turn the box on first, then power the Roku TV.

– If using direct coax, power on the Roku TV; you can run the scan afterward.

Set Up Channels on Roku TV

The channel scan on Roku is the step that turns an RF cable signal into a usable live channel guide. If you connected coax/RF to the Roku TV, you’ll want to run the built-in tuning process so the TV can detect available channels and build the on-screen list.

When I configure Roku TVs in real environments, the scan results depend on two factors: (1) the quality and consistency of the signal entering the RF input, and (2) the correct region/country tuning settings. Even when the physical coax is correct, a mismatch in country/region settings can reduce channel detection.

Roku’s channel scan/find channels feature builds a local channel list by detecting available RF channels at the connected “Antenna/Cable” input.
Running a rescanning process is the standard way to refresh channel listings after provider lineup changes or new signal equipment is installed.

Run the scan (and what the prompts mean)

– Run the Roku channel scan/find channels option

– On Roku: Settings → TV inputs → (select Antenna/Cable) → Channel scanning / Find channels (exact wording varies by model).

– Follow on-screen prompts to complete tuning and channel listing

– Choose the correct signal type if asked (Cable vs Antenna).

– Wait for completion; Roku will populate a channel list you can browse in Live TV.

Cable vs. Antenna: what’s the difference in Roku?

If your source is truly cable (provider RF) rather than over-the-air broadcast, select Cable (or Cable TV) when Roku asks. Using Antenna mode can reduce channel detection because the scan expects different frequency/channel mapping.

Use HDMI If You Have a Cable Box

If your cable provider gives you a cable box, HDMI is usually the cleanest and most reliable way to watch live channels on a Roku TV. In this setup, Roku acts as the display while the cable box handles channel tuning, decryption, and guide data.

In my experience, HDMI setups are also easier to stabilize. Once you select the right HDMI input, live channel switching is managed by the cable box’s remote and Roku shows the video feed. Roku’s job then becomes input selection, audio routing, and picture settings.

When a Roku TV is connected via HDMI to a cable box, channel navigation is controlled by the cable box and Roku switches only HDMI inputs.
Selecting the correct HDMI input in Roku is required for live cable viewing when the provider signal is delivered through an external box.

– Connect your cable box to an HDMI input on the Roku TV

– Use a labeled HDMI port (e.g., HDMI 1).

– Select the correct HDMI input and manage basic channel switching through the cable box

– Choose the HDMI input that matches your physical connection.

– Use the cable box remote for channel up/down and guide functions.

Common HDMI “gotchas” include using a loose HDMI cable, plugging into the wrong HDMI port, or leaving the TV on a different input source. If you see a “no signal” message, power-cycle in this order: cable box → Roku TV, then reselect the HDMI input.

Q: Do I need to run Roku channel scanning if I use a cable box?
Usually no—when using HDMI from a cable box, the box provides the channel lineup, and Roku simply displays that HDMI feed.

Troubleshoot If Cable Channels Don’t Appear

When cable channels don’t show up, the goal is to isolate whether the issue is physical connectivity, input selection, scanning state, or signal activation. Most “missing channel” problems resolve once the Roku input, connection seating, and signal strength/activation are verified in order.

In troubleshooting sessions, I typically follow a strict sequence: confirm the correct Roku input, confirm cables are seated, verify the provider service is active, then rescans (for coax). This avoids random changes that make it harder to identify the root cause. Also, because signal issues can be intermittent, rescanning at the end matters.

If Roku is set to the wrong TV input (HDMI vs Antenna/Cable), live channels will not appear even if the physical cable connection is correct.
Rescanning channels after verifying the coax connection is a standard method to rebuild the channel list when lineup or tuning data changes.

Fast diagnostic checklist

– Re-check cable seating, port selection, and any required adapters

– Tighten coax connectors; avoid cracked cable jackets.

– Confirm Roku is on TV input = Antenna/Cable (for coax) or the correct HDMI input (for box).

– Try rescanning channels and confirm signal strength/activation with your provider

– Run Find channels / channel scan again after fixing wiring.

– If the provider requires an activation step, confirm your account status and whether they’ve pushed a refresh.

Quick comparison: likely cause vs. fix

Symptoms Likely Cause What to Do Next
No channels found on scan Wrong scan mode (Antenna vs Cable) or weak/incorrect RF input Select “Cable” mode and re-run channel scanning after confirming coax seating
Blank screen on HDMI input Wrong HDMI port or inactive cable box output Select the correct HDMI input and power-cycle the cable box
Picture appears, guide/channels missing Provider provisioning not completed or lineup refresh needed Confirm activation status with your provider and re-scan if using coax

When You Might Need Extra Equipment

Sometimes the barrier isn’t Roku—it’s the signal path and connector compatibility. Extra equipment is only necessary when your wall outlet, cable type, or provider setup doesn’t match Roku’s expected inputs.

For example, a common scenario is having an RF/coax wall outlet but a different connector at the TV end, or having equipment that effectively splits the signal in a non-standard way. Another scenario is when you try to route through adapters that reduce signal quality. The guiding principle: use equipment that’s designed for the RF/HDMI signal type you actually need.

A direct RF-to-HDMI converter can work only when the source is a compatible RF feed and the converter supports the relevant standards for live TV capture.
If Roku scanning fails repeatedly with a coax feed, the issue is often signal provisioning or weak delivery rather than a Roku limitation.

What “extra equipment” usually means

– Use an RF-to-HDMI converter only if your ports don’t match (and verify compatibility)

– Verify it supports your input frequency range and output format (HDMI) for live television.

– Note: some converters may introduce latency or compress the signal, which can impact channel responsiveness.

– Consider a cable box upgrade or updated signal setup if scanning fails repeatedly

– If you don’t have true direct-to-TV support, a cable box (or alternative provider equipment) is the correct route.

– If signal quality is degraded by splitters or old cabling, replacing cables/splitters can resolve missing channels faster than repeated scans.

How do you connect a cable box to a Roku TV?

Start by connecting one end of an HDMI cable to the HDMI output on your cable box and the other end to an HDMI port on your Roku TV. Then power on both devices and use your Roku TV remote to switch to the matching HDMI input (e.g., HDMI 1 or HDMI 2). If your cable box supports it, enable HDMI-CEC so the TV and cable box can work more seamlessly for power and input switching.
